Are you passionate about languages and dedicated to inspiring young minds? We are seeking a dynamic and enthusiastic Modern Foreign Languages (MFL) Teacher to join our thriving secondary school in Rochdale this September.
We are looking for a committed and innovative MFL specialist (French and/or Spanish preferred) who can deliver engaging and effective lessons across Key Stages 3 and 4. The successful candidate will be a team player with a strong subject knowledge and the ability to bring language learning to life.
This role is open to both full-time and part-time applicants, making it ideal for teachers seeking flexible working arrangements.

All pay rates quoted will be inclusive of 12.07% statutory holiday pay. This advert is for a temporary position. In some cases, the option to make this role permanent may become available at a later date.
Teaching Personnel is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children. We undertake safeguarding checks on all workers in accordance with DfE statutory guidance ‘Keeping Children Safe in Education’ this may also include an online search as part of our due diligence on shortlisted applicants.
We offer all our registered candidates FREE child protection and prevent duty training. All candidates must undertake or have undertaken a valid enhanced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S) check. Full assistance provided.
